Safety checklist

  • Check the domain carefully (typos and look‑alikes are common).
  • Avoid “Download Manager” wrappers and fake green buttons inside ads.
  • Scan the file with your antivirus before running it.
  • Prefer signed installers; if hashes are provided, verify them.

Common issues and fixes

  • File extension unknown: Check the filename extension and only open it with the correct app.
  • Downloaded file won’t open: Try re-downloading; verify it wasn’t blocked or partially downloaded.
  • Windows warns about the file: If you trust the source, scan it; otherwise delete it.
  • Archive won’t extract: Use a trusted archiver and confirm the download completed fully.

FAQ

How do I know a downloaded file is safe?

Verify the source, scan it, and check signature/hash when available.

What does “blocked by Windows” mean?

SmartScreen/Defender flags unfamiliar files; check publisher and source.

What’s the safest way to open an installer?

Close other apps, run antivirus scan, then run the installer from official source.

What if a file extension is hidden?

Enable file extensions in your file explorer settings so you can see the real type.

Should I disable antivirus to install?

No. If a site asks that, treat it as a major red flag.
